
Panevėžys is a city in Lithuania. It is the fifth-biggest city in Lithuania with population of 119,000, situated on the shore of the River Nevėžis not far from the Via Baltica highway between Vilnius and Riga.
Panevėžys has no commercial airport of it's own, but has three international airports within the 150 km radius - Vilnius International Airport (VNO) to the south-east, Kaunas International Airport (KUN) to the south and Riga International Airport (RIX) in Latvia to the north. Those airports serve number of destinations in Europe and beyond.
There is a regular train only running from Šiauliai to Rokiškis through Panevežys.
Panevežys is easily accesible by international road Via Baltica connecting Warsaw, to Riga and Tallinn that crosses Kaunas in Lithuania. There are about 130 km from Kaunas till Panevežys by Via Baltica.
The most important attraction in Panevežys is Cido Arena built in 2008. Arena generally hosts basketball games as well as concerts; also it has an indoor 250 m long olympic cycling track, the only such in the Baltic States. Cido Arena is capable to accommodate up to 7,300 people during the concerts, a little less for sports events.
